I’m working on a custom hardware design for the Raspberry Pi Compute Module 5 (CM5). I want to connect an NVMe SSD to the CM5 via USB 3.0 using a USB-to-PCIe bridge IC.

My goal is to boot the Raspberry Pi CM5 directly from the SSD connected through this bridge. I’m specifically looking for a USB 3.0 to PCIe bridge IC (not a ready-made adapter) that is compatible with the Raspberry Pi, and known to support booting from the attached SSD.

Has anyone tried a similar setup or can recommend a suitable IC that works reliably in this use case?
